Unveiling the Best MT4 Indicators:

  1. Moving Averages:

Like a compass pointing true north, moving averages smoothen market fluctuations, revealing underlying trends. They provide a clear visual representation of price action, enabling traders to identify support and resistance levels. The 200-day moving average is revered for its reliability in spotting long-term trends.

  1. Relative Strength Index (RSI):

The RSI oscillates between 0 and 100, indicating market conditions ranging from oversold to overbought. When the RSI hovers below 30, it signals potential buying opportunities. Conversely, values above 70 suggest selling pressure.

  1.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D):

The MACD is a momentum indicator that measures the difference between two exponential moving averages. When the MACD line crosses above the signal line, it indicates bullish momentum, while a downward cross signifies bearishness.

  1. Fibonacci Retracement Levels:

Fibonacci numbers permeate the natural world, and their application in forex trading unveils harmonic patterns in price action. Retracement levels provide potential areas of support and resistance after significant market moves.

  1. Ichimoku Cloud:

The Ichimoku Cloud is a complex indicator that encompasses multiple timeframes, revealing trends, support and resistance levels, and potential trading zones. Its versatility makes it a favorite among experienced traders.

  1. Stochastics Oscillator:

The Stochastics Oscillator compares the closing price to the price range over a specified period. It ranges from 0 to 100, indicating oversold or overbought conditions. Divergences between the oscillator and price action can provide valuable trading signals.
